What Shapes the Value of Your Jaguar in Arizona

Several factors come together when determining what your Jaguar is worth, and understanding them helps you set realistic expectations before you submit. Mileage and model year are obvious starting points — a low-mileage XF or F-PACE commands more attention than a high-mileage older XJ — but the story doesn't end there. Trim level, optional packages, and the presence of a complete service history all influence the number significantly. Condition matters enormously for luxury vehicles. Prescott sits at nearly 5,400 feet in elevation, and while the cooler temperatures are gentler on engines than the Phoenix valley floor, UV exposure at altitude is intense. Paint fade, cracked leather from dry air, and sun-damaged dashboards are common on vehicles that spent years parked outside here. Keeping maintenance records and noting any recent work — tires, brakes, timing chain service — adds credibility and value to your vehicle. Local market demand is real too. Jaguars aren't as common in Yavapai County as they are in Scottsdale or Paradise Valley, which can affect resale dynamics. Working with a buyer who understands the statewide Arizona market means your car is evaluated against a broader pool of comparable vehicles, giving you a fairer read on what it's actually worth right now.

Selling a Jaguar With a Loan or Remaining Balance

One of the most common concerns we hear from Prescott sellers is what happens when there's still a loan on the vehicle. The short answer is: it's manageable, and it happens all the time. The key figure is your payoff amount — the exact dollar figure your lender requires to release the title. You can get this directly from your lender, and it may differ slightly from your current balance due to interest accruals. If the offer on your Jaguar exceeds your payoff amount, the difference comes back to you. If you owe more than the vehicle is currently worth — a situation sometimes called negative equity or being upside down — you'll need to cover that gap. This is more common with newer Jaguars that depreciated quickly in the first few years, or with longer loan terms. It's worth knowing your numbers before you start the process so there are no surprises. What's My Car Worth Arizona works through the lien release process routinely. You don't need to resolve the loan before reaching out — we'll walk through the details with you once an offer is in hand. Sellers in Prescott, Prescott Valley, and the surrounding communities have navigated this successfully, and having a clear offer in front of you is the best first step.

Selling Outright vs. Trading In at a Dealership

If you're planning to buy another vehicle, trading in your Jaguar might seem like the easy path. You hand over the keys, they knock something off the purchase price, and you drive home in something new. But the convenience often comes at a cost. Trade-in values are frequently lower than what a direct buyer will offer, because the receiving party needs to build in profit margin for resale. That gap can be significant on a luxury vehicle like a Jaguar. When you sell directly to What's My Car Worth Arizona first, you separate the two transactions. You know exactly what your Jaguar is worth before you walk into any negotiation about your next vehicle. That clarity is a real advantage. You're not bundling two deals into one and hoping the math works out in your favor. For Prescott residents, this approach also opens up more flexibility in what you buy next. You can shop locally, go through a private seller, or explore options in Flagstaff or the Phoenix metro without feeling locked in. Selling your Jaguar independently keeps your options open.
